How Cultural Differences Influence International Marriages
A key feature impacting cross-cultural unions is cultural diversity. Couples often deal with variations in cultural traditions, core values, customary practices, and ways they communicate. Such disparities can cause challenges and emotional barriers, though with mutual respect and openness, they might broaden the partnership by fostering cross-cultural enrichment.
For example, one partner hailing from a collectivist society might prioritize family decision-making, while the other partner may prefer personal independence. Such dynamics calls for negotiation and respect to sustain balance.
Communication challenges also play a significant role cross-border unions. Fluency levels may be uneven, leading to difficulties in expressing emotions and making daily exchanges tougher.
Legal and Logistical Aspects of International Marriage
Marrying across national borders entails complex legal procedures. Among these are visa applications, residence permits, marriage certificates, and recognition of the marriage in each country. Each country has its own unique regulations, making it necessary for couples to research and comply with them.
Additionally, issues related to property rights, inheritance, and child custody. Seeking counsel from attorneys expert in such legal systems helps facilitate smoother legal navigation.
